References

[B] Richard Bamler, Cheeger-Colding-Naber Theory.

[C] Jeff Cheeger, Degenerations of Riemannian metrics under Ricci curvature bounds.

[CC] Jeff Cheeger, Tobias Colding, On the structure of spaces with Ricci curvature bounded below. II.

[CN] Jeff Cheeger, Aaron Naber, Regularity of Einstein Manifolds and the Codimension 4 Conjecture.

[CG] Jeff Cheeger, Gang Tian, Anti-Self-Duality of Curvature and Degeneration of Metrics with Special Holonomy.

[CJN] Jeff Cheeger, Wenshuai Jiang, Aaron Naber, Rectifiability of singular sets in noncollapsed spaces with Ricci curvature bounded below.

[JN] Wenshuai Jiang, Aaron Naber, L2 Curvature Bounds on Manifolds with Bounded Ricci Curvature.

[R] Xiaochun Rong, Notes on manifolds of Ricci curvature bounded below.

[S] Gábor Székelyhidi, Kähler Einstein metrics.
